Well, the term “Hard Money” does not necessarily mean that this money is hard to obtain. On the contrary, in reality, Hard Money loans are one of the easiest funds that one can procure.

Generally speaking and following the definition of the money market industry “Hard Money” is primarily the “unconventional asset-based lending.” In this specific type of money lending, there is a sort of collateral security for the loan offered and this collateral is ideally in the form of a real estate. However, Hard Money lending is considered to be unconventional because these loans ideally do not meet the traditionally set and required underwriting criteria of any Institutional Lenders or ILs.

A Hard Money Lender or HML was also known as Private lenders will be typically the lender of last resort as the loan has its unconventional characteristics that may be in the form of:

  • Fast funding timeline

  • Different types of loan and

  • A liberal and flexible credit score of the borrowers.

These private lenders include pension funds, real estate funds, private individuals that have enough money available in hand to lend and insurance companies. However, a few of these may have deep pockets while the others may have limited resources to lend.

HMLs usually lend money based upon their own criteria and primarily on a short term basis. There is no restriction for the borrowers who can use this fund for a variety of profitable and useful purposes. These may also include the following real estate loan types:

  • Bridge

  • Development

  • Refinance

  • Acquisitions and

  • Rehab.

Hard Money is typically more expensive than any traditional loans taken from any other sources carrying a rate of interest over and above 10%. In addition to that, you can also expect a 2 % or more added to it as the origination fees. This means you will need to have considerable financial upside to avail and use these sources. Remember, such private lenders may charge an up-front application fee from you. Along with that, they may charge a commitment fee and a due diligence fee as well. Make sure that you find out about these and understand everything about these fees while selecting a Hard Money Lender. This is due to that fact that all these fees are usually non-refundable and therefore you will have no recourse once you sign on the loan agreement.

As per the terms a Hard Money lender generally will:

  • Fund a loan for 50% LTV on raw land

  • Give a loan of up to 70% LTV on the finished product

  • Charge an interest rate of more than 10%

  • Give the loan for a short period ranging from six months to three years and

  • Also, charge an origination fee lying anywhere between 2 and 10 points that is to be paid out of the proceeds.

Usually, all Hard Money loans are either interest only or amortized. This means that a few of these lenders will fund interest, rehab money, origination fees, and others while others may not. Good financing option

There are lots of reasons why Hard Money lending can be a very good financing option for you. These are:

  • Banks, credit unions and other Institutional Lenders will usually fill in your need for cheap money that you will be glad and able to use on all real estate deals. However, these ILs will not fund a specific market that is out there due to government regulations, lower risk profiles, stricter underwriting guidelines, longer funding timelines and much more. This is the particular segment that the Hard Money Lenders serve and support their reason for existence and success.

  • Fast access to loans is another reason for the existence and survival of the Hard Money Lenders. The speed at which most HMLs can fund can be beyond the imagination and expectation of the other financial institutions. HMLS can ideally grant a loan in less than two weeks’ time after receiving all the essential documentation while most Institutional Lenders will take at least 60 days and more if at all they grant your loan that is.

  • Low documentation requirement of the HMLs as compared to the ILs is another reason you may choose them. They usually grant a loan based on the value of the property which is their primary factor for considering a loan and not the borrower’s credit or financial status.

  • There is no credit issue raised by the HMLs which is typically required by the ILs for any borrower. That means you can avail a loan from a HML even if you have a FICO score of less than 500, had a recent bankruptcy or foreclosure.

  • Flexibility is optimal in case of HMLs when it comes to structuring the loan which the ILs is much stricter of. These are in terms of the loan term, interest reserve, cash out, and draw schedules, financing carry, and others.

Ideally, the HMLs bridge financing with their experience in real estate lending. They know that projects will not always follow the given plan and will fund gap loans if the supporting documentation makes sense.
